6.1 Modes of Reproduction: As discussed in reproduction of animals class 8 science chapter 6 ncert solution, Reproduction is the process of creating new members of the same species. There are two primary ways of reproduction: sexual reproduction and asexual reproduction.

6.2 Sexual Reproduction: As discussed in reproduction of animals class 8 science chapter 6 ncert solution, in animals, males and females have different reproductive parts or organs. Just like in plants, the reproductive parts in animals also create gametes that fuse together to create a zygote, the zygote that develops into a whole new individual. This type of reproductive process begins from the fusion of the male and female gametes. This fusion of gametes is known as sexual reproduction.

6.3 Asexual Reproduction: As discussed in reproduction of animals class 8 science chapter 6 ncert solution, Asexual reproduction is the process of creating offspring without the use of gametes, or the combination of genetic material from both parents. A single parent organism can produce genetically identical offspring, called a clone, in this mode. Asexual reproduction tends to be less complicated than sexual reproduction, and can be beneficial in stable and predictable conditions.

Key Features of Class 8 Science Chapter 6

  • There are two ways of reproducing in animals: sexual reproduction and asexual reproduction. 

  • Sexual reproduction involves the fusion of a male and a female’s gametes. In females, the reproductive organs are ovaries and uteruses. 

  • In males, the reproductive organs include testes, sperms and penises. The ovaries of females produce female gamets called ova, while the testes of males produce male gamets called sperms. 

  • The fusion of the ovum and the sperm is referred to as fertilisation, and the fertilized egg is called “zygote”. Internal fertilisation occurs inside the female’s body, and is observed in humans, other animals and dogs.

  • External fertilisation takes place outside of the female body. This is what we see in frogs, fishes, starfish etc.

  • Zygotes divide repeatedly to give birth to an embryo. The embryo gets inserted into the uterine wall for further growth.

  • The stage of an embryo where all the body parts are visible is called a fetus.

  • Animals like humans, cows and dogs that give birth to babies are called viviparous animals. 

  • Animals like chickens, frogs, lizards and butterflies, which lay eggs, are called oviparous animals. 

  • The larva changes into an adult through drastic changes called metamorphosis

  • Asexual reproduction takes place when only one parent is involved. This is asexual reproduction.

  • In hydra, new organisms form from buds. This is called budding.

  • An amoeba divides itself into two to reproduce. This is called binary fission.

Question 1: What is reproduction in animals?

Answer 1: Reproduction in animals is the process of creating new individuals of a common species to ensure the continuity of that species.

Question 2: What is a zygote?

Answer 2: Zygotes are the result of the fusion of two gametes, namely the sperm and the egg, during fertilization. A zygote contains the complete genetic material necessary for the formation of a new individual.
